KUWAIT CITY, Feb 28: The Public Relations and Coordination Unit at the Medical Emergency Department successfully implemented its contingency plan for the national holidays from Feb24-26, reports Al-Jarida daily quoting Unit Head Waleed AlOthman.
Al-Othman disclosed 12 centers were established throughout the country to ensure immediate and appropriate response to emergency situations. He said the department dealt with a total of 454 cases during the holidays through the coordinated efforts of 10 clinics, 35 ambulances and 101 paramedics in various locations.
Praising the efforts of the employees in the unit and the entire department, Al-Othman asserted they all worked hard during the holidays to give the best services to the people.
Meanwhile, Kuwait Fire Service Directorate (KFSD) will organize the 11th Firefighting Day from March 7-9 in Souk Sharq Mall under the auspices of State Minister for Cabinet Affairs Sheikh Mohammad Al-Abdullah, reports Al-Qabas daily.
In a recent press statement, the directorate revealed many activities have been lined up for the event to raise public awareness on the dangers of fire, ways to deal with fire incidents and prevention methods. Many institutions like the Ministry of Defense, National Guard, Kuwait Oil Company (KOC), different sectors affiliated to the directorate and others are expected to attend the event.
Meanwhile, sources confirmed the directorate’s plan to carry out a series of intensive campaigns in camping sites to ensure strict compliance with the safety and security regulations. Sources warned strict measures will be taken against those proven to have violated the regulations.
